Question 417792: What the vertex and the axis of symmetry for
the parabola with the given equation.
y = 5x^(2) - 30x + 47
Answer by rfer(16322) (Show Source): You can put this solution on YOUR website!
a=5, b=-30, c=47
30/10=3 Axis
(3,2) vertex
no zero's
